Transaction bfbf13fda96a0e2885349ae4b56de96dbe801e72234bd06dfa2d2178b5288afa
1 Input
2 Outputs
- bfbf13fda96a0e2885349ae4b56de96dbe801e72234bd06dfa2d2178b5288afa:0
- bfbf13fda96a0e2885349ae4b56de96dbe801e72234bd06dfa2d2178b5288afa:1
value 265741
address 14D43PWSPQbPvUCBqhm4nKXxV4sKXu1jES
value 9711660
address 18F8myqLHehBeZwaGkx1xKKo3aiBMLFby4